If I could I would give HP zero stars

If I could I would give it zero stars.
I ordered a pc on 4th September last week and the order summary said ‘next day delivery’.
Foolishly, I imagined that it would be delivered the next day, as per eg Amazon.
But no, it appears it means ‘next day after we have got round to processing your order’
My order was placed 5 days ago, and apart from an email confirming the order I have heard nothing. The ‘track my order’ just says ‘processing’ so I asked for an update on 6th Sept which was ‘due within 48hrs’ but 96 hrs have passed and still nothing. The HP store chat bot is woefully over-subscribed (you are 25th in a queue). The HP store customer service number (+44 (0) 20 7660 3859) says ‘due to unforeseen circumstances we are not taking calls’. In other words no way of checking order status.
Altogether one of the worst customer experiences I have ever encountered? HP: WHAT is going on??
